Mosaic backsplash installation involves fitting decorative tile pieces-often made of glass, ceramic, or stone-onto the walls behind sinks, stoves, or countertops in kitchen or bathroom areas. This service includes preparing the surface, applying adhesive, carefully placing each tile to create a cohesive design, and grouting to seal the joints. The result is a visually appealing, durable surface that enhances the overall look of the space while providing a functional barrier against moisture and stains. Professional installers ensure the tiles are properly aligned and securely affixed, delivering a polished finish that can elevate the style of any room.
This service helps address common problems such as outdated or damaged backsplashes that may have cracks, stains, or loose tiles. Replacing or updating a backsplash with a mosaic design can also prevent water damage and mold growth by creating a protective surface that resists moisture. Additionally, a new mosaic backsplash can serve as a focal point, adding personality and color to a kitchen or bathroom. For property owners experiencing peeling, chipped, or discolored tiles, professional installation offers a fresh, long-lasting solution that can boost the property's overall appeal.

The overview below groups typical Mosaic Backsplash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Royse City,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small-Scale Backsplash Installations - Many smaller projects, such as adding a new backsplash in a kitchen or bathroom, typically cost between $250 and $600. Local pros often handle these routine jobs efficiently, with most projects falling within this middle range. Fewer jobs reach the higher end of the spectrum, which can exceed $600 for more intricate designs.
Mid-Range Backsplash Replacement - Replacing an existing backsplash with more detailed tile patterns or larger areas usually ranges from $600 to $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ners updating their spaces, with costs varying based on tile material and size. Larger or more complex installations can push beyond this range, reaching $2,000 or more.
Full Wall or Kitchen Backsplash Installation - Extensive installations covering entire walls or large kitchen areas typically fall between $1,500 and $3,500. Many local contractors handle projects within this scope, though highly customized or premium materials can increase costs. Larger, more elaborate designs may exceed $4,000 in some cases.
Complex or Custom Backsplash Projects - Highly detailed, custom, or multi-material backsplash installations can range from $3,500 to over $5,000. These projects are less common but are suited for homeowners seeking unique designs or intricate tile work. Costs can vary significantly depending on the complexity and materials involved.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a mosaic backsplash? A mosaic backsplash can enhance the aesthetic appeal of a kitchen or bathroom, add texture and color, and provide a durable surface that is easy to clean and maintain.
What materials are commonly used for mosaic backsplashes? Common materials include glass, ceramic, stone, and metal tiles, each offering different styles and finishes to suit various design preferences.
Can local contractors customize mosaic backsplash designs? Yes, many service providers offer custom design options to match specific styles, color schemes, or patterns desired for the space.
What factors should be considered when choosing a mosaic backsplash? Factors include the overall decor style, durability requirements, ease of cleaning, and the specific area where the backsplash will be installed.
